To successfully simulate the process of genetic material formation, begin by arranging the colored strings into pairs. Each string represents a different type of nucleotide, and the pairing process follows base-pairing rules. Make sure that the complementary colors are correctly paired together as adenine pairs with thymine, and cytosine with guanine. This method mimics the double helix structure of genetic information.

Next, carefully twist the paired strings together to form a spiral. This step is crucial as it visually demonstrates the twisting nature of DNA in living organisms. Pay attention to the spacing between each twist to ensure the proper representation of the helical structure. If done correctly, you will have created a simple, yet effective, model of the genetic sequence.

To further understand the intricacies, label each part of the model with their respective roles. This will reinforce how genetic material stores the information for protein synthesis. Remember, each step in the process builds on the last to provide a clear representation of how genetic traits are passed down from one generation to the next.
